  • 讨论了γ射线照射对电熔石英玻璃的吸收光谱和介电谱的影响,研究结果表明:γ射线照射电熔石英玻璃,不影响它的羟基含量;增加色心浓度,增加的倍数与样品有关;将减小石英玻璃的ColeCole圆半径或介电常数.

     

    Dielectric behavior and optical absorption of quartz glasses before and after irradiating were investigated. Experimental results demonstrate that complex dielectric function of quartz glasses is changed by the irradiation. Its magnitude is decreased by the irradiation. In addition, the change in the dielectric function does not relate to the hydroxyl group in quartz glasses. Experiments also show that dielectric function is relating to the color centers in quartz glasses. Contribution of color center to dielectric function is dependent on its sort and amount in quartz glasses. Dielectric constant decreases with increasing the density of color center
